Metro
and City staff are supportive, but there is sharp competition in the
region for these Regional Flexible Funds.
The $444,800 Willamette Greenway Trail package is
one of the remaining projects still in the running for part of the
$21.65 million. The next step is consideration at a joint meeting of
the Metro Council and JPACT on February 12, 2009, 4:00 PM. (JPACT
is bureaucratic jargon for a group of elected officials and others from
around the Metro Region that make decisions on Federal Transportation
dollars that come into our area.) After reviewing all input, they will
vote to approve projects at
the March 5th Metro Council meeting.
